Exactly How Roofing System Ventilation Functions



Efficient roof covering ventilation depends on the all-natural activity of air to develop a balance in between intake and exhaust. When you set up vents, you're essentially permitting fresh air to enter your attic room while enabling hot, stagnant air to escape. sky remodeling manage temperature level and dampness levels, protecting against issues like mold growth and roof covering damage.

Consumption vents, generally located at the eaves, reel in cool air from outside. Meanwhile, exhaust vents, located near the ridge of the roofing system, allow hot air rise and exit. The distinction in temperature level develops an all-natural air movement, known as the pile result. As cozy air increases, it creates a vacuum that draws in cooler air from the lower vents.

To maximize this system, you need to make sure that the consumption and exhaust vents are appropriately sized and positioned. If the intake is limited, you won't achieve the desired air flow.

Similarly, inadequate exhaust can catch warmth and dampness, leading to prospective damage.

Trick Installment Considerations



When installing roofing system ventilation, numerous essential considerations can make or break your system's performance. First, you require to analyze your roof covering's layout. The pitch, shape, and products all affect air flow and air flow choice. Make sure to select vents that match your roof kind and neighborhood environment problems.

Next off, take into consideration the placement of your vents. Preferably, you'll want a well balanced system with intake and exhaust vents positioned for optimal air movement. Location intake vents low on the roofing system and exhaust vents near the peak to urge a natural flow of air. This setup helps avoid dampness build-up and advertises power efficiency.


Do not forget about insulation. Proper insulation in your attic stops heat from running away and keeps your home comfy. Guarantee that insulation does not block your vents, as this can prevent air flow.

Finally, think of maintenance. Pick ventilation systems that are easy to access for cleansing and examination. Routine maintenance ensures your system continues to work successfully gradually.
